Transaction d6498bf6157fe8c88c98985648367938e42c292326923f35f125b142535c159c

1 Input
2 Outputs
  • d6498bf6157fe8c88c98985648367938e42c292326923f35f125b142535c159c:0
  • value  610702495
    address  1J4WGueunNTKiFyYYU2bKSLqSxEu3xtVDh
  • d6498bf6157fe8c88c98985648367938e42c292326923f35f125b142535c159c:1
  • value  19289229705
    address  17499RkhXx2fCD8CLY2mQuMMyQcPwohXZr